Transaction 1ab88a3abe135c2679f57de44137372705366e294d21998e3a03e70a40ad7f5a

1 Input
2 Outputs
  • 1ab88a3abe135c2679f57de44137372705366e294d21998e3a03e70a40ad7f5a:0
  • value  2379000
    address  1HfoP2bW3A5SWhJkUjtepCP72biCvNup9V
  • 1ab88a3abe135c2679f57de44137372705366e294d21998e3a03e70a40ad7f5a:1
  • value  23856269
    address  126qdawv3eTc8pW5YjKS7kKdxQtgnoYwPy